Mob Leveling

Every hostile mob now has a level. Here's everything that's new.

Leveled Mobs

  • Every hostile mob (all of them except the Ender Dragon) now spawns with a random level from 1 to 50.
  • Higher levels are rarer than lower ones, so most mobs you run into will still be low-level, but every so often you'll stumble into something dangerous.
  • A mob's level boosts its health, damage, and movement speed.
  • Skeletons (and Strays/Wither Skeletons) get deadlier archery at higher levels (faster, harder-hitting arrows).
  • Creepers get a bigger blast radius as their level goes up. A level 50 creeper is charged.
  • No mob ever spawns with extra armor or weapons because of its level.

Nameplates & Boss Bars

  • Every leveled mob shows its level, name, and current health above its head, color-coded by level bracket
  • Below that, a floating tag shows its tier (see below), in the same color as its level.
  • Mobs above level 30 get a boss bar on screen, showing its name, level, and how far away it is. Only the 3 closest active boss bars display at once. Boss bars are currently a donor rank (PLUS or above)

Tiers, XP, and Loot

Every mob belongs to one of six tiers based on its level:

Tier Levels
Initiate 1–8
Elite 9–16
Master 17–25
Scion 26–33
Demon 34–41
Devil 42–50
  • Killing a leveled mob gives XP scaled to its level.
  • Each tier has its own loot table. Higher tiers can drop coal, iron, gold, diamonds, emeralds, redstone, and money notes (right-click one to deposit it straight into your balance).

Death Messages

  • If a leveled mob kills you, the death message now tells you its tier, level, name and how much health it had left.

The Boss Iron Golem

A rare boss spawn:

  • Every so often, a Level 60 "Boss Tier" Iron Golem may spawn near a player, struck by a bolt of lightning).
  • Its arrival is broadcast to everyone on the server, along with its coordinates.
  • Unlike normal iron golems, this one is actively hostile toward players, not just other mobs.
  • Boss music plays for anyone within 50 blocks of it, following it as it moves, and stopping once you're out of range.
  • It drops significantly more loot and money than any other mob.
  • If someone lands the final blow, the kill is broadcast to the whole server.
  • If it goes 5 minutes without being hit by a player, it gives up and disappears on its own.
  • Only one can ever be active at a time.

Stats & Leaderboards

  • The plugin tracks your kills, deaths (to leveled mobs), boss kills, and assists (credited if you damage a mob but someone else finishes it off).

 

BustaMine

Bustamine has been redone, we've built a custom plugin for it just as we did for the mob leveling.

How to Play

  1. Open the menu with /bustamine (or /bm).
  2. During the betting window, adjust your bet in the menu (-100/-10/-1, +1/+10/+100) and hit CONFIRM BET to lock it in.
  3. Once the round starts, a multiplier begins climbing from 1.00x. Hit CASH OUT any time to lock in your payout at the current multiplier.
  4. If you don't cash out before the round busts, you lose your bet.

Odds

The bust point is fully random every round, there's no fixed pattern or predictable cycle. Every multiplier from 1.00x upward is possible, including the rare instant bust at 1.00x.

Messages

Round-start and bust notifications only go to players who placed a bet that round, not the whole server. Cashing out shows you the multiplier you hit, your payout, and your profit for that bet.

Stats

/bustamine stats shows overall rounds played, total wagered, and the highest cashout multiplier hit so far.
